Despite a lengthy drought, flowers appeared in their many enticing colors. Our front entrance was covered with azaleas and outlined by roses. The back saw the emergence of freesias and camellias. Unfortunately, the hyacinths didn’t do well due to the arid soil and warm April temperatures. However, we were pleased with the flowers that did bloom in the spring.
